blueloveTH 0891000a46 init
2022-11-06 12:16:57 +08:00

20 lines
583 B
YAML

name: build
on: [push, pull_request]
jobs:
build_win:
runs-on: windows-latest
steps:
- uses: actions/checkout@v2
- uses: ilammy/msvc-dev-cmd@v1
- name: Compiling
shell: bash
run: |
CL -std:c++17 -utf-8 -O2 -EHsc -Fe:pocketpy src/main.cpp
mv src/pocketpy.h src/pocketpy.cpp
CL -std:c++17 -utf-8 -O2 -EHsc -LD -Fe:libpocketpy src/pocketpy.cpp
- uses: actions/upload-artifact@v3
with:
name: pocketpy
path: |
D:\a\pocketpy\pocketpy\pocketpy.exe
D:\a\pocketpy\pocketpy\libpocketpy.dll